Responsibilities
Collect specimens according to established procedures, including drug screens, biometric screening and insurance exams.
Administer oral solutions according to established training.
Research test/client information and verify orders using lab technology systems.
Enter data accurately and efficiently into computer systems.
Obtain identification, enter billing information, and collect payments as required.
Process specimens: labeling, centrifuging, aliquoting, freezing, and preparing for transport.
Perform non‑patient facing duties: inventory, stocking, sanitizing, filing, answering phones and managing email.
Read, understand and comply with departmental policies, protocols, and procedures.
Assist with compilation and submission of statistics and data.
Maintain phlebotomy logs (maintenance, temperature) in a timely manner.
Complete online and in‑person training courses as required.
Qualifications
Three years phlebotomy experience, including pediatric, geriatric, and capillary collections.
Keyboard/data entry experience.
Flexible and available for weekends, holidays, on‑call, and overtime.
Valid driver’s license, reliable transportation, and clean driving record.
High school diploma or equivalent.
Medical assistant or paramedic training preferred.
Phlebotomy certification preferred; required in California, Nevada, and Washington.
